Remote sensing-derived level-area models have been widely used in inundation analysis of large lakes. The current study aimed to optimize the model for Poyang Lake, the largest freshwater lake in China, where the hydrological connections are highly dynamic and complex. Based on the combination of RS and GIS technology, with the method of threshold and spatial analysis, we study the distribution of snails in Honghu City in the year of 2001. The result shows that there are 82.77% areas of snail distribution in ditch which distributes as linearity and network.
